DescriptionBack to top

Turner Hill is a private equestrian facility dedicated to teaching and educating both children and adults about the love and accoplishment being with horses can bring you and how to understand them so that both the human and horse can interact freely and safely. We currently have lesson and after schhol programs aswell as our extremely affordable 8 hour summer daycamp.

Although our camp centers on equine education, in order to better understand horses and how to be successful in our camp they must learn patience, teamwork, compassion, responsability, good work ethics, and how to reach goals. Between the times when the studentsare not with there horses we teach them the history, health, physiology, parts of equipement, and the different disciplines taught and used throughout the world from gymkhanas to classical dressage.
